Purpose

The settler node models a secondary clarifier (settling tank) that receives mixed liquor from an upstream reactor node. It simulates:

  • Gravity settling of suspended solids
  • Sludge blanket height tracking
  • Return Activated Sludge (RAS) concentration
  • Effluent quality (clarified water)
  • Waste Activated Sludge (WAS) removal

Upstream Connection

The settler receives effluent from a reactor node. The reactor registers as an upstream child, and the settler pulls effluent data on state changes via the getEffluent method.

Integration note: The _connectReactor method expects getEffluent to return an array. This was a known bug fixed on 2026-03-02.
